Cardinal Duka: Pope Leo XIV knows the consequences of communism
It is common knowledge that Pope Leo XIV knows his home country, the USA, and his missionary country, Peru. But he is also familiar with the evil consequences of communism in Eastern Europe.

Leo XIV, the first pope from the USA, is apparently a convinced anti-communist - because of the painful experiences of his religious community in Eastern Europe. This was reported by the former Archbishop of Prague, Cardinal Dominik Duka (82), to the Roman daily newspaper "Il Messaggero" (Monday). According to Duka, the then superior of the order, Robert Prevost, now Pope Leo XIV, visited the Czech Republic "at least ten times". As superior of the Augustinians (2001 to 2013), he was intensively involved in the reconstruction of religious life after 40 years of communist persecution.
